Market continues to slide

Similarly, the wide-based National Stock Exchange index Nifty declined by 7.10 points, or 0.14 per cent, to 4,917.15. Trading sentiment remained bearish on sustained selling by funds and retail investors on weak GDP growth amid a weak trend in Asian region.
India's economic growth rate slowed to a nine-year low, both in the March quarter at 5.3 per cent as well as in 2011-12 at 6.5 per cent. In the Asian region, the Japan's Nikkei fell by 0.74 per cent, while Hong Kong's Hang Seng shed 0.74 per cent in early trade. The US Dow Jones Industrial Average ended 0.21 per cent lower in yesterday's trade.
